Ceiling Leak Repair Service in Littleton, CO
Ceiling leak repair services address issues caused by water infiltration that results in damage or staining on interior ceilings. These projects typically involve identifying the source of the leak, which may originate from plumbing fixtures, roof leaks, or HVAC systems, and then restoring the affected ceiling surfaces. Homeowners often request this service after noticing water spots, discoloration, or sagging ceilings, and they us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the cause of the leak, and the necessary repairs to prevent future issues.
Before requesting ceiling leak repairs, property owners should consider whether the leak is ongoing or has been addressed, as this impacts the repair approach. It’s also helpful to know the location and severity of the water damage, as well as any underlying causes such as roof issues or plumbing problems. Clear communication about the visible damage and any related concerns can assist in planning an effective repair, ensuring the ceiling’s integrity and appearance are properly restored.

Ceiling Leak Repair Service Questions
What causes ceiling leaks? Ceiling leaks are often caused by roof damage, plumbing issues, or HVAC condensation that allows water to seep into the ceiling material.
How can I tell if my ceiling has a leak? Signs include water stains, discoloration, sagging drywall, or peeling paint on the ceiling surface.
Is it necessary to repair the ceiling after a leak? Yes, repairing the ceiling is important to prevent further damage, mold growth, and to restore the appearance of the space.
What types of ceiling leak repairs are common? Common repairs include patching water-damaged drywall, sealing leaks, and addressing underlying issues like roof or plumbing repairs.
